Output 14bef3ef6250e3fa50e2a9f031bd4eabd1179aed97b7758c809abb3bdb1f938f:14

value
21459376
script pubkey
OP_0 OP_PUSHBYTES_20 d1d612573c9f58f46a7ea1e559c04b7e165ea99d
address
ltc1q68tpy4eunav0g6n758j4nszt0ct9a2va0rzks8
transaction
14bef3ef6250e3fa50e2a9f031bd4eabd1179aed97b7758c809abb3bdb1f938f
spent
true